Summer fun is just around the corner! On Saturday, June 6th, the Sizzlin’ Summer Series reurns with exciting events like a children’s farmers market themed story trail, robot races, an evening movie screening, and so much more! The series offers 10 fun, free summer events for everyone to enjoy most Saturday’s on the Burnsville Town Square! With something for all ages, the Sizzlin’ Summer Series encourages everyone to stay active and engaged with the community.

Created by Healthy Yancey, a coalition organized with support from Partners Aligned Toward Health (PATH), the Sizzlin’ Summer Series aims to increase community connections, promote physical activity, and highlight fun ways to be active during the summer months. Activities are appropriate for ALL ages and abilities and are completely FREE.

Join the fun Saturdays on the Burnsville Town Square from 10am to 12pm, unless otherwise indicated below. Highlights of the Sizzlin’ Summer Series schedule include:

 

June 6 – Brain Games & Yard Games: Summer Fun for Every Generation. Hosted by Dementia Caregivers and Friends, Appalachian Youth to Youth, and Partners Aligned Toward Health.

June 13 – Lil’ Sprouts Children’s Farmers Market *from 9:30 am to 11:30 am.* Hosted by the Blue Ridge Partnership for Children.

June 20 – Grow, Play, Celebrate Resilience! Hosted by The Beacon Network and American Red Cross in partnership with Yancey County Long Term Recovery Group.

 

June 27 – Feel Good, Move More! Hosted by RHA Health Services and Partners Aligned Toward Health in partnership with Communities in Motion.

July 4 – There won’t be a Sizzlin’ Summer Series event so you can enjoy 4th of July festivities on the Square.

July 11 – Reading is Alive: “No Signal on the Mountain.” Hosted by Parkway Playhouse and Penland School of Craft.

July 18, Morning – Preparedness Palooza: Ready, Set, Resilient! Hosted by Asheville Buncombe Community Christian Ministry (ABCCM), Faith 360 Network with support from Glenn Raven.

July 18, Evening- MCHP’s Movie on the Square *arrival time is 7:45 pm with movie starting at 8:15pm.* Hosted by Mountain Community Health Partnership.

July 25 – Bikes and Wheels *from 9:00 am to 11:00 am.* Hosted by Partners Aligned Toward Health and AmeriHealth Caritas NC. Afterwards join AMY Wellness Foundation for their open house building tour *11am to 1pm* at the soon-to-be Lamp Post Lofts (127 W. Main Street).

August 1 – Robot Races and Carnival Crazes. Hosted by Full Steam Ahead Carolina and Yancey County Health Department.

August 8 – There won’t be a Sizzlin’ Summer Series event so you can enjoy the Mount Mitchell Crafts Fair *from 9:00 am to 5:00 pm.*

August 15 – Back to School Bash from *10:00 am to 2:00 pm.* Hosted by The Yancey County Sheriff’s Office and Yancey County Schools.

Many community partners come together each year to make the Sizzlin’ Summer Series a success. Each week is implemented by a different sponsoring organization (listed above with each event), which is responsible for creating, funding, and staffing their event.

Thank you to the title sponsor AdventHealth, as well as the Town of Burnsville, and Yancey County Government, along with other community sponsors for their support which makes the 2026 Sizzlin’ Summer Series possible.

This summer you can also enjoy free pool days at the Burnsville Pool on June 22, July 16, and August 7, courtesy of Healthy Yancey and the Yancey County Government.
